Sat 758889134134076

decimal
151777.4134134076
degree
0°151777′577″4134134076‴
percentile
36.137577855659735%
name
ilzbwxbeoyf
cycle
0
epoch
0
period
75
block
151777
offset
4134134076
timestamp
rarity
common